a premed with Tylenol and Benedryl cannot hurt! Many Dr tell you too, many do not mention it. Mine never did, but I did tell them I premed Tylenol and Benedryl. They did not care, but I was the only one who premed. I was just scared as I am sure you were. I premed my 1st 5 infusions. I did not on my 6th and all still went fine. I think my body needed to adjust to TY. I would do the same again. I wanted to play it safe and I think I needed to. This is just MHO.

If u decide to premed again, I would not tell them. I think it is your choice. Many may disagree with me, but there is little I now have control over and I will or will not premed as I alone deam necessary.
